On March 5, it was reported by Shams Charania of The Athletic that the Los Angeles Lakers and free-agent guard Dion Waiters had agreed on a deal for the remainder of the season.

Charania added that conversations between the two parties had been positive. But the Lakers do reserve the option to release Waiters if it doesn’t work out.

Interestingly, a short time after the news broke, Charania did a further report via video. More details were publicised, as well as the following:

“The Lakers are still holding out the option of potentially adding a shooter down the line. They worked out JR Smith as well on Monday.”

It appears that the Lakers may not be done yet and maybe holding out for another shooter. It is assumed that it may come at the expense of Quinn Cook or Jared Dudley if this was to occur.

JR Smith was worked out on the same day that the Lakers worked out Dion Waiters, so he could be an option. Other free-agent shooters include; Allen Crabbe and Jamal Crawford.
